Transaction 38f5c2e35fc66e1981f24630f33f11c58bfceb568744fe85cdcb3c29cad09891
1 Input
1 Output
-
38f5c2e35fc66e1981f24630f33f11c58bfceb568744fe85cdcb3c29cad09891:0
- value
- 563954
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 955e2244badf4c4b475fdad1134e73a38920881a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cnT7rCkaeARJVq7wCh3jZ1XndxPHhzVS